Description
If you are considering a career in professional valuation services, your journey should begin with
Basic Appraisal Principles
. This four-day course will introduce you to real property concepts and characteristics, legal considerations, influences on real estate values, types of value, economic principles, real estate markets and analysis, highest and best use, and ethical considerations. The course will provide a solid foundation in basic appraisal principles no matter what appraisal specialty you pursue. By successfully completing the course and exam, you will have met most states?education requirements in the content area identified as basic appraisal principles.
Co-developed by the Appraisal Institute, ASA, and ASFMRA
